I've done italian, french, japanese lvl 1.

But i've always been confused about the "when you start tomorrow, start at track no. 2".

Does it mean : redo lesson 2 and then back to the next lesson? or start at lesson 2 and do 3,4,5 and so on ?

Whats the point in repeating lesson 2 again and again?

Confused: "start at Pimsleur track no. 2" Thu Jul 12, 2007 16:43 pm  Confused: "start at Pimsleur track no. 2"
 

Torsten wrote:
The entire Pimsleur system is based on constant repetition and the idea is to redo any lesson until you have the material down. That's why you have to repeat every previous lesson before you move on to the next one.


That is not correct. You only redo a lesson if you haven't mastered more than 80% of its contents. You are expected to move to the NEXT lesson every day and complete a comprehensive course in roughly 30 days. The tag "start at Pimsleur track no. 2" is indeed a tag found on the odd numbered units (units 1, 3, 5, etc.) of the CD version and implies to move to the second track on the CD on the following day. If you ripped the CD version to an MP3 format that might explain why you have that tag in the audio. Some of the early Pimsleur digital downloads also had the confusing tag until the problem was caught by the company. These days the standard tag for every unit is "This is the end of Unit X and the end of today's lesson. Please continue with the next unit tomorrow."
